Output ebc078f5c32d1649169d3aa6f2c1d4281ef48c3d1b5c962ce37a26f1060aa7c4:15

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 8c754203fd774aecfea71bb60c7b7d7652f7e856
address
tb1q3365yqlawa9wel48rwmqc7mawef006zkrvtuw4
transaction
ebc078f5c32d1649169d3aa6f2c1d4281ef48c3d1b5c962ce37a26f1060aa7c4